Transaction ea8631320463821dbc71787bfe044eb2c5f255840313ce6ed4b294372d7dfb9a
1 Input
1 Output
-
ea8631320463821dbc71787bfe044eb2c5f255840313ce6ed4b294372d7dfb9a:0
- value
- 7935893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4dd12acecdbfb3484483f913c49bcb16c90b574c OP_EQUAL
- address
- MEzcqPpRuEnJCK4LYg6HQh6fj3fcjfzXm4